I just saw on Dear Author this AM that they are accusing Jordin Williams of plagiarizing passages of Tammara Webber's very popular New Adult book, Easy. Jordin Williams' book is called Amazingly Broken. Passages were included from both books to show that the ones in Amazingly Broken were exactly the same as the ones in Easy. If you were thinking about buying Jordin's book, you might want to check out the accusation before you buy. Plagiarism is just plain wrong, so I'd hate to see a dishonest person profit off Tammara's really great book.
